Have you heard of super agers? It sounds like we’re talking about a super hero like Superman, but super agers are people just like you who happen to age really well — meaning they look years younger than their actual age. Do you ever wonder what their secret is? Skin care researchers certainly do! In fact, there have been several studies on super agers.
While there’s no definitive “magic potion” for becoming a super ager, research indicates that your lifestyle has a stronger impact on how well you age than genetics!
So, without further ado, here are a few research-based tips for aging better:
1. Wear sunscreen every day of the year.
The research is undeniable on the benefits of UV protection and reducing skin cancer risk. What you may not realize is just how important sunscreen is to the appearance of your skin. It is estimated that up to 90% of your skin’s aging (lines, wrinkles, age spots, freckles) are caused by sun exposure, not Father Time. Need we say more to motivate you?

2. Think positive.
Could your attitude use some freshening up? When was the last time you laughed at yourself? The benefits of positive thinking are immeasurable. Research has long established strong links between optimism and better overall health. Positive thinking has been shown to lower blood pressure and stress, reduce disease risk and even brighten your skin. The mind is a most powerful beauty tool, indeed!
3. Embrace hyaluronic acid (HA) serums.
A study on super agers a few years back discovered that women who reported having dry skin were 30% less likely to be super agers. While dry skin is genetic, you can help your skin along by keeping it hydrated with the correct skin care products.
